Selectboard signs on to VTrans grant for pedestrian bridge scoping and Trail to Town study

Town of West Windsor Selectboard · June 8, 2026

The board authorized the Mount Ascutney Regional Commission to submit an $82,500 VTrans Bicycle & Pedestrian Grant application (20% local match) to scope replacement of the pedestrian bridge behind the fire station and improvements to the Trail to Town.

The Town of West Windsor on June 8 authorized the Mount Ascutney Regional Commission to submit a VTrans Bicycle and Pedestrian Grant application seeking $82,500.00 to fund a scoping study for replacement of the pedestrian bridge behind the fire station and improvements to the Trail to Town that connects the mountain to the village. Otis Ellms-Munroe of MARC presented the grant application and a draft letter of support and noted the application includes a 20% local match.

Otis also said that a separate proposed crosswalk project could not proceed in this grant cycle because the State requires any crosswalk across a state highway to connect to a sidewalk on both sides. The Selectboard authorized Mark Higgins to execute the Letter of Support and authorized MARC to submit the application on the Town’s behalf.
